Output e821351686a996b16926730e2f4dc293e20a9c69cdb1c26f617ea720fa23a8e7:1

value
2149766
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7c206a4647c9d83fc781b80df663839d672ebd82 OP_EQUALVERIFY OP_CHECKSIG
address
1CKKd2k21YJTfW2hYnm1vpKuvhiw6ybNey
transaction
e821351686a996b16926730e2f4dc293e20a9c69cdb1c26f617ea720fa23a8e7
confirmations
517588
spent
true